Kinds of Treadmills
When it comes to picking a treadmill, it is vital to comprehend the different types readily available in the market. Here are the main categories:
1. Manual Treadmills
- Mechanism: These treadmills have an easy style and count on the user's efforts to move the belt.
- Pros: More economical, quieter operation, no electricity required.
- Cons: Limited functions, may not provide the exact same series of workout strength.
2. Motorized Treadmills
- System: Powered by a motor that drives the belt, allowing users to stroll or perform at a set speed.
- Pros: Greater variety of speeds and inclines, geared up with many features such as heart rate displays and exercise programs.
- Cons: More pricey and might require more maintenance.
3. Folding Treadmills
- System: Designed for those with minimal area, these treadmills can be folded for simple storage.
- Pros: Space-saving, typically motorized, versatile features.
- Cons: May be less resilient than non-folding models.
4. Industrial Treadmills
- Mechanism: High-quality machines designed for use in fitness centers and fitness centers.
- Pros: Built to withstand heavy use, advanced features, frequently include service warranties.
- Cons: Pricey and not perfect for home use due to size.
5. Curved Treadmills
- System: A distinct style that enables users to propel the belt utilizing their own energy.
- Pros: Offers a more natural running experience, promotes better running type.
- Cons: More costly and can be noisier.

Advantages of Using Treadmills
Treadmills offer many benefits that can contribute to one's general fitness goals. Some of these advantages include:
- Convenient Workouts: Treadmills enable users to work out inside your home no matter weather.
- Cardiovascular Health: Regular usage can improve heart health by increasing stamina and promoting healthy circulation.
- Weight Management: Effective for burning calories, which helps in weight loss and management.
- Personalized Workouts: Users can manage speed, slope, and period to produce customized exercise experiences.
- Security: Treadmills supply a foreseeable surface, minimizing the threat of falls compared to outdoor running.
- Multifunctional: Many treadmills included functions like heart rate screens, exercise programs, and even entertainment systems.
Selecting the Right Treadmill
When selecting a treadmill, potential buyers must think about a number of essential aspects:
Features to Consider:
- Motor Power: Typically determined in horsepower (HP), a motor strength of a minimum of 2.5 HP is advised for major runners.
- Belt Size: A longer and larger belt accommodates various stride lengths, offering convenience throughout workouts.
- Incline Settings: Adjustable slope functions imitate outdoor hill running and can increase exercise strength.
- Weight Capacity: Ensure the treadmill can support the user's weight for safety and longevity.
- Console Features: Look for easy to use control panels, exercise programs, and Bluetooth compatibility for streaming music or other functions.
Budget Considerations
- Under ₤ 500: Entry-level manual treadmills appropriate for casual walkers.
- ₤ 500 – ₤ 1,500: Mid-range motorized treadmills that offer more features and better sturdiness.
- ₤ 1,500 – ₤ 3,000: High-end designs with innovative innovation, larger motors, and longer service warranties.
- Over ₤ 3,000: Commercial-grade treadmills perfect for frequent usage in fitness centers or training facilities.
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. How often should I utilize a treadmill?
It is advised to utilize a treadmill a minimum of three to five times a week, integrating different intensity levels for best outcomes.

3. What is the best speed to walk on a treadmill for novices?
A speed of 3 to 4 miles per hour is a suitable range for beginners. It's necessary to begin slow and gradually increase pace as convenience and endurance enhance.
4. Do I require to use a treadmill if I currently run outdoors?
Utilizing a treadmill can offer additional benefits, such as regulated environments and varied workouts (incline, periods) that are not constantly possible outdoors.
5. How do I keep my treadmill?
Regular maintenance consists of lubricating the belt, cleaning up the deck and console, and checking the motor for ideal efficiency.
